133: Is Organ Transplantation a Blessing of Modern Science?

Andrea Schwartz

Podcast: Out of the Question
Topics: ,

Examining the variety of issues surrounding organ transplantation is the subject of this 133rd episode of the Out of the Question Podcast. Charles Roberts returns to co-host.


Subscribe to the Podcast

iTunes Google Spotify RSS Feed